Quick Bite – Mountain View Diner, Frederick, MD 🤯
There is a deep, comforting soul to this kitchen that simply cannot be replicated by microwave-heavy franchise operations.
While the big highway fast-food stops rely on portion-controlled frozen products, the hardworking crew here continues to hand-craft monumental comfort classics that focus on real ingredients and massive portions.

The building itself is a preserved marvel—a factory-assembled modular steel structure shipped straight from the New Jersey manufacturing yards back in 1989.
Operated with a fierce commitment to old-school hospitality, this gleaming roadside legend proudly retains its status as a definitive mom and pops and hole in the wall favorite for the entire county.

Signature Bites – Mountain View Diner, Frederick, MD 😋
-
Crab Cake Benedict: A spectacular coastal twist on a brunch favorite, featuring two seasoned, pan-seared crab cakes benedict layered over toasted muffins with poached eggs and creamy hollandaise.
-
Country Fried Steak: A heavy-duty comfort plate featuring a tender, crispy-fried beef cutlet completely smothered in a thick, seasoned white country gravy.
-
Hot Open-Faced Turkey: A deeply nostalgic diner staple stacking thick, oven-roasted turkey slices over soft white bread, drenched in a rich turkey gravy with a side of fluffy mashed potatoes.

-
Homemade Rice Pudding: A wonderfully creamy, sweet dessert cup crafted in-house daily, finished with a generous dusting of ground cinnamon.
-
Giant Cinnamon Buns: A legendary morning treat featuring a warm, spiral-rolled iced cinnamon bun glazed with sweet icing.
-
Maryland Crab Soup: A spicy, comforting bowl packed with tender crab meat, mixed vegetables, and a robust tomato-based broth seasoned with Old Bay.
